Led by kindness, compassion and dignity our highly trained care teams deliver the kind of care and nursing we would want all our loved ones to receive. Our four care homes across Lincoln provide residential care, short-term respite care, nursing and specialist dementia care.

• Warm inclusive family atmosphere • Person centred dementia care • Meaningful activities • Spacious en-suite bedrooms • Light and airy dining & lounge areas • Daily fine dining 12 19
